Position Overview:
Pelvic/Abdominal and Transvaginal Ultrasounds: Provide pelvic/abdominal and transvaginal ultrasounds for our OB/GYN patients.
Collaboration and Reporting: Collaborate and share reports with referring physicians.
Care Coordination: Assist in the coordination of care within the Women’s Health department and other departments as needed.
HIPAA Compliance: Strictly adhere to HIPAA standards and regulations in managing or handling any patient information or patient inquiries.
Miscellaneous Tasks: Effectively perform a variety of other assignments and projects as may be required.
Minimum Qualifications:
- Certified in New York State
- ARDMS certified
- Minimum of 2 years of recent OB/GYN experience
